What companies run services between Larkfield, England and Invicta Grammar School, England?

Southeastern operates a train from East Malling to Maidstone East hourly. Tickets cost £5–6 and the journey takes 7 min. Alternatively, Arriva Kent & Surrey operates a bus from Wealden Hall to Chequers Bus Station every 20 minutes. Tickets cost £2–4 and the journey takes 26 min. Nu-Venture also services this route once daily.
